These products were found on the markets of various member states of the European Union

On Monday, the Consumer Protection Service (YPK) of the Ministry of Energy, Trade and Industry, as the competent authority, published 49 products for the week that began on April 8 (RAPEX – Report 15) that present a risk to the health and safety of consumers in Cyprus for the operation and management of the European Rapid Information Exchange System for Dangerous Products that are not foodstuffs. The announcement includes all eight products related to the Consumer Protection Service.

It is noted that these products were detected in the markets of various member states of the European Union and then notified to the Safety Gate RAPEX System, while consumers can be informed about the dangerous products on the website of the Ministry of Health.

As explained, the 49 products were allocated for market control purposes as follows: Eight to the Consumer Protection Service, 14 to the Labor Inspection Department, 8 to the Road Transport Department, 7 to the Pharmaceutical Services Department, 5 to the Electromechanical Services Department, 4 to the Environment Department, 2 to the Health Services and 1 in Health Services – Detergents Sector.

It is noted that the 8 products related to the Consumer Protection Service, as well as the corresponding associated risks are thoroughly described in this table.

As described in the table, the first product is an adapter (with Wi-Fi option) brand ENERGEEKS, model EGEW003MC (package) 22/51-08- 02200 (product), with barcode 8436581540482 and made in China. It is noted that there is a risk of electric shock due to the fact that the insulation of the product is insufficient with the risk of the user suffering an electric shock from the accessible live parts.

The second product is a Jojo Maman Bébé brand pacifier support chain, with barcodes 5054298261983 and with country of manufacture China. It is pointed out that there is a risk of suffocation due to the possible ingestion of small objects that are easily detached from the chain.

The third product is a LIVING NATURE dinosaur soft toy, model PELUCHE BRACHIOSAURUS, manufacture code PRODUCT CODE AN420 with barcode 5037832307217 and country of manufacture UK. It is reported that there is a choking hazard from possible ingestion of small objects that are easily detached from the toy.

The fourth product is a toy with magnets of an unknown brand, models LEC210906118A/[F04A13D5-06]/220109124939451024 and made in China. It is noted that there is a choking hazard from the possible ingestion of the small parts (the magnets) that can be easily detached.

The fifth is also a toy with STEM brand magnets and an unknown country of manufacture. Again it is pointed out that there is a risk of choking due to the possible swallowing of the small parts (magnets) which can be easily detached.

The sixth item is a Flying Tiger Copenhagen brand toy sword, model 3050473, all make codes, with barcode 0200030504732 and made in China. Please note that there is a chemical and choking hazard due to the fact that the battery case breaks easily, leaving the button batteries accessible.

The seventh product is a Konges slojd brand digital bathroom thermometer, model KS5319, build code 122022, with barcode 5715404091336 and made in China. It is noted that there is a risk of suffocation.

The last product is soft toys in the form of various colorful animals of an unknown brand and made in China. It is noted that there is a risk of suffocation from possible swallowing of small objects that are easily detached from the toys or from the fibrous filling material of the toys.

It is noted that the products with serial numbers 1 to 7 have been evaluated by the European Commission as serious risk products, while product number 8 has been assessed by the European Commission as a lower risk product.

It is reported that the Consumer Protection Service calls on importers, distributors and sellers who may have such products to immediately stop making them available and notify the Service.

It is noted that the Consumer Protection Service also calls on consumers, in case who own the products in question, to stop using them and return them to the seller, i.e. to the store from where they were purchased and at the same time inform the seller accordingly.

It is also noted that, according to the Consumer Protection Law of 2021, in case of purchasing an unsafe product, the consumer is entitled to a replacement of the product, so that the product is in accordance with the terms of the sales contract. If this is not possible, then the consumer has the right to withdraw, i.e. to return the product to the seller and receive back the full amount paid.
